1. East Fork State Park

OUTDOOR RECREATION PARADISE | BATAVIA OHIO


East Fork State Park is one of Ohio's largest state parks, offering 4,870 acres of diverse recreational opportunities. The park features a 2,160-acre lake for boating and fishing, 46 miles of hiking trails, and a 1,200-foot swimming beach. Visitors can enjoy camping, picnicking, and wildlife viewing in this scenic natural setting.



2. Tri-State Warbird Museum

AVIATION HISTORY SHOWCASE | BATAVIA OH


The Tri-State Warbird Museum in Batavia showcases a remarkable collection of World War II-era aircraft. Visitors can explore over 20,000 square feet of exhibits featuring restored warplanes, educational displays, and interactive programs. The museum offers a unique opportunity to experience aviation history up close.



3. Sycamore Park and Wilson Nature Preserve

RIVERSIDE RECREATION & NATURE | BATAVIA OH


Sycamore Park and Wilson Nature Preserve offer a peaceful escape along the East Fork of the Little Miami River. The park features paved trails, picnic shelters, and a playground, while the adjacent 145-acre nature preserve provides hiking trails and wildlife viewing opportunities. Visitors can enjoy kayaking, fishing, and exploring the diverse ecosystems.

6. Starlite Drive-In Theater

NOSTALGIC MOVIE EXPERIENCE | AMELIA OH


The Starlite Drive-In Theater in nearby Amelia offers a nostalgic movie-watching experience. Operating since 1947, this classic drive-in features digital projection and FM radio sound. Visitors can enjoy double features under the stars, with a variety of concessions available. It's a perfect outing for families and movie enthusiasts alike.

10. Cincinnati Nature Center

NATURE EXPLORATION & EDUCATION | MILFORD OH


The Cincinnati Nature Center, located near Batavia in Milford, offers over 1,000 acres of forests, fields, and streams to explore. With 20 miles of hiking trails, educational programs, and seasonal events, it's a perfect destination for nature lovers and families. Visitors can enjoy birdwatching, photography, and immersive outdoor experiences year-round.
